    3. Hello list, I have a question I am hoping someone can answer. I am trying to track my ancestors: Michael Fitzgerald. "Minerva" 1800. sentence: Life. and Mary Wood. (I'm unsure if she was a convict or not) Michael Fitzgerald & Mary Wood were married at Port Dalrymple 16 March 1811, and their children Maria and William were baptised the same day. In 1809, a Mary Fitzgerald was granted 30 acres of land at PD. Michael Fitzgerald was also given a conditional pardon, and land grant the same year. Now, presuming Mary Wood was living with Michael Fitzgerald ( as they had two children by 1811) could this be Mary Wood? Or is the Mary Fitzgerald likely to be another person? To confuse me more, I have found birth records for: Mary Fitzgerald born Feb 1791, Norfolk Island & Mary Wood, born Nov 1794, Norfolk Island. In 1805, some convicts were sent from NI to VDL, a Michael Fitzgerald is listed among them. I am trying to determine if both Marys' were sent to VDL then also. Can anyone advise if Mary Wood could have been listed on the land grant as "Fitzgerald", even though she was not yet legally married to Michael Fitzgerald? with thanks, Lesley Wilson.
